NHTSA Engineering Analysis EA26002: Tesla FSD Reduced-Visibility Crash Investigation (3.2M Vehicles)

NHTSA upgraded its Tesla Full Self-Driving investigation to an Engineering Analysis covering 3,203,754 vehicles, the step typically preceding a recall. The probe examines FSD failure in reduced-visibility conditions, with nine documented incidents including a pedestrian fatality.

Jurisdiction: United States · Effective 2026-03-18
